Austrian resorts, many of which are relatively low, have been investing heavily in snowmaking, and it takes only five days of sub-zero temperatures for the Ski Amadé region to cover all its 760km of slopes, many of which are below 1,000 metres. Åre, short for Årefjällen, is located in Åre Municipality, just outside and above the village of Åre, approximately 80 km from the city of Östersund. The ski resort Åre is located in Åre (Sweden, Northern Sweden (Norrland), Jämtland).For skiing and snowboarding, there are 91 km of slopes available. The altitude of the solar panels that cover Zermatt’s highest restaurants makes them up to 80 per cent more effective than in the rest of Switzerland. Back in 2008, Whistler, the biggest resort in North America, calculated that its lifts, which carry 59,000 people an hour, used the same energy as 68 Porsche Boxsters. And SkiWelt in Austria, with its 284km of pistes and 90 lifts, only uses hydropower for snowmaking – plus it also has a lift in Brixen that is entirely solar-powered. Åre is located in the central part of Sweden, and is one of Scandinavia's largest ski resorts, consisting of 5 ski areas with a total of 40 ski lifts and 103 runs. The ski lift system is on the Åreskutan mountain, with a summit elevation of 1,420 m, which is not lift-served, but is reachable by snowmobile. Studies show that there are now 38 fewer days of natural snow every winter in the Swiss Alps compared to the 1970s, and 23 fewer days in the area around Chamonix Mont Blanc, which is one of a handful of French resorts to hold the flocon vert (green snowflake) label for its environmentally friendly initiatives. The tri-cable system used in the gondola that from this season links Grindelwald to the Eiger glacier, 6.5km away, is so stable in high winds that no path had to be cut through the forest to accommodate it – it soars over the trees with the aid of just seven pylons. In North America, it is more common for ski areas to exist well away from towns, so ski resorts usually are destination resorts, often purpose-built and self-contained, where skiing is the main activity.
